Quote:
Originally Posted by POCKETRACINGBIKES View Post
I tried that mod years ago and it works well,try the bzm reeds ,they have a better variety than the polini ones and are better quality.
only problem with bzm reed's they dont really fit they are wider than polini and it makes it harder to make the spacer as the spacer need's a wider hole in center if you trim the bzm reed's down they work, thats wat im runing and have had no problems
